Показаны сообщения с ярлыком советы. Показать все сообщения
Показаны сообщения с ярлыком советы. Показать все сообщения

17 марта 2012

Зачем нужно сопроводительное письмо

Многих фрилансеров, и особенно начинающих, волнует вопрос: зачем нужно сопроводительное письмо и как его писать. Это может быть не столь актуально в России, но если вы планируете получить зарубежный проект, или устроиться на работу в зарубежную компанию - вам не удастся проигнорировать этот вопрос. Речь пойдет о том, что называется cover letter.

Все сказанное далее относится больше к зарубежным компаниям, чем к российским. Если вы ищете проекты на oDesk или Elance, то вы попали по адресу.

Написание сопроводительного письма часто кажется очень сложной задачей. Отчасти это так, но после небольшой тренировки вы можете стать экспертом по написанию сопроводительных писем. Сопроводительное письмо обычно прикладывается к каждому резюме, которое вы отправляете. Это непросто понять, но это так. В англоговорящей среде сформировался некий этикет деловой переписки, который нужно соблюдать. Поэтому ваше сопроводительное письмо может повлиять на то, получите ли вы проект/работу или же ваше резюме просто отправится в мусорку. Так что имеет смысл уделить определенное время и силы на написание эффективных сопроводительных писем.

Сопроводительное письмо должно дополнять, а не дублировать ваше резюме (если оно есть). Его цель - в интерпретации данных, указанных в резюме и установлении личного контакта. Сопроводительное письмо - это, зачастую, ваш первый контакт с клиентом или работодателем, поэтому постарайтесь не испортить первое впечатление.

Существует 2 основных типа сопроводительных писем:
  1. Письмо-заявка - это ответ на определенную вакансию или проект (job opening);
  2. Письмо-"разведка" - в нем вы спрашиваете о возможном трудоустройстве (такой вариант часто используется, когда вы ищете работу "неважно где").
Ваше сопроводительное письмо должно быть составлено отдельно для каждой цели, описанной выше и для каждой позиции в отдельности. Не стоит создавать заготовку и отправлять ее всем подряд - это очень хорошо видно, и ваше письмо просто отправится в мусор даже не будучи прочтенным.

Эффективное сопроводительное письмо объясняет причины вашего интереса к конкретной организации и позиции и определяет ваши самые необходимые навыки и опыт. Они должны выразить высокий уровень интереса и знаний о вакансии или проекте. 

Не пускайте дело на самотек, уделите 10 минут на написание хорошего сопроводительного письма - и ни один клиент не пройдет мимо.

29 августа 2010

Календарь+parseInt == нетривиально

Не так давно довелось использовать код javascript dropdown календаря от Martijn Korse. Все было хорошо, пока не случилась одна вещь: календарь перестал отдавать правильную дату. Точнее, день выдавал правильный, а вот месяц нет. Но все оказалось еще сложнее...
В нескольких местах в коде используется функция parseInt(). Все было хорошо, пока в функцию не стала передаваться строка с ведущим нулем, да еще и с числом больше 8 (уже догадались, да?). Казалось бы, parseInt("08")=8, а parseInt("09")=9, но это не так. parseInt("09")=0! O_o
Почему?
Наверное, мало кто задумывается об этом... Документация по функции говорит, что функция ведет преобразование до первого невалидного символа, то есть как только встречается невалидный символ, преобразование прекращается и функция возвращает, что она до этого момента напреобразовывала... И второй момент: система счисления определяется автоматически по виду строки. То есть 0x123 автоматически распознается как шестнадцатиричное число, а число с ведущим нулем - как восьмеричное.
Вот теперь становится понятно, почему parseInt("05")=5, а parseInt("09")=0. Пятерка - валидный восьмеричный символ, а девятка нет. Поэтому parseInt("09") возвращает результат до девятки, то есть НОЛЬ. Если бы число совсем не удалось бы преобразовать - результатом был бы NaN.
Решение: явно указывать основание системы счисления вторым параметром функции. Например, parseInt("09", 10) вернет 9.

10 мая 2010

Code Convention

«Пишите код так, как будто сопровождать его будет склонный к насилию психопат, который знает, где вы живете.»
(с) Steven C. McConnell

Кажется, больше ничего говорить и не надо...

08 апреля 2009

oDesk = еРабство 2.0? Мнение...

В блоге дяди Эдика я обнаружил статью (точнее ее перевод), пусть и не последней свежести, но ее прочтение наводит на некоторые мысли.

Для тех, кто не в курсе, рассказываю: известная биржа удаленной работы oDesk использует для мониторинга рабочего процесса исполнителей специальную программу, которая следит за активностью мыши и клавиатуры, а также периодически делает снимки экрана.
Автор рассказывает какой это кошмар и сравнивает это с рабством (паранойя?). Я не привык смотреть на вещи однобоко, поэтому давайте разберемся так ли плоха эта слежка из oDesk.

Во-первых, многие организации и так вольно или невольно следят за своими сотрудниками, вряд ли сотруднику позволят целый день раскладывать пасьянсы или трепаться по телефону. Не говоря уже о камерах видеонаблюдения. Так что работать под присмотром придется в любом случае.

Во-вторых, если вы работаете честно и ни на что не отвлекаетесь, не смотрите "сиське" и не читаете Хабр вместо работы, то вам нечего скрывать, пусть хоть снимки экрана делают, хоть полное видео процесса. Остальным есть повод побеспокоиться...

В-третьих, нужно как-то отчитываться за отработанное время, и способ, предложенный oDesk едва ли не самый подходящий. Веб-камеру вы можете не цеплять (может кто-то работает в одних трусах), а все остальное не вызывает отрицательных эмоций в рабочее время (по крайней мере у меня). Кроме того, можно выбрать проект с фиксированной платой, где вас не спросят про то, как вы работаете. Я уже писал про проекты с фиксированной и почасовой оплатой.

Кому нечего скрывать - спят спокойно (и платят налоги), всем остальным - нечего делать на oDesk и во фрилансе вообще. Любая работа, на которую вы соглашаетесь - дело добровольное, вы сами выбираете с кем работать и как работать. Это кстати относится не только к фрилансу, но и к любой другой работе. Я не понимаю людей, которые трясутся за свое место и при этом терпят начальника самодура. Не нравится - меняй работу.

Жизнь человека зависит только от него самого, не нравится - не делай.

31 октября 2008

Фриланс: Бизнес и кризис

Тема мирового финансового кризиса у всех на слуху, и сейчас не пишет об этом только ленивый. Но мы рассмотрим эту проблему с другой точки зрения: как в условиях кризиса фрилансеру не только сохранить свой прежний уровень доходов, но и увеличить его.

Можно строить множество прогнозов относительно того, как кризис отразится (или уже отражается) на бизнесе (не побоюсь этого слова) фрилансеров и студий. От самых пессимистичных (денег нет - бизнеса нет - все замирает), до оптимистичных (рынок поколебался и успокоился, все успокоились и все возвращается на свои места). Мы же рассмотрим вариант, который ближе к реалистичному (ну кому как...).

Итак, какой бы ни была ситуация в мире, не нужно думать, что раньше трава была зеленее. Возьмем быка за рога: сейчас самое лучшее время чтобы расширить свой бизнес во фрилансе и заработать кучу денег.

Но тут возникает 2 вопроса: как и почему.

Почему?
Любой бизнес - это прежде всего люди. А люди склонны ошибаться и подвергаться влиянию эмоций. Значит и бизнесы делают то же самое.
Сейчас все бросились экономить: кто на спичках, кто на еде, кто на чем. Компании проводят сокращения кадров, избавляясь от "ненужных" людей, которые ничего не производят. Кому-то урезают зарплату. Студия Лебедева, например, заставила своих сотрудников голодать, отказавшись от бесплатных обедов.
На этой волне было бы логично предположить, что некоторые компании начнут смотреть в сторону фриланса (это мнение может быть и ошибочным), пытаясь таким образом сэкономить.

Как?
Вот 10 способов увеличения собственного marketability (извиняюсь за французский, но адекватного русского перевода с ходу не нашел), ну и зряплаты заодно:
  1. Округляте свою ставку так, чтобы клиент видел круглую сумму (не кругленькую!). Например, многие биржи фриланса берут определенный процент, так вот, надо установить такую сумму, чтобы клиент платил на 127$, а 130 или 120. С почасовой ставкой аналогично. Хотя здесь можно поспорить и применить подход, принятый в магазинах: вместо 30 писать 29.95 - уже вроде бы и не тридцать, а двадцать девять.
  2. Просите отзывы и рекомендации. Счастливый клиент напишет вам хоть 10 отзывов - ему все равно, а вам приятно.
  3. Изучайте профили фрилансеров с такими же как у вас skills (опять французский), но с более высокой ставкой. Что есть у них, чего нет у вас?
  4. Расширяйте свои skills. Узнайте, что пользуется спросом - то и изучайте.
  5. Сдавайте skill тесты и онлайн сертификации.
  6. Вносите в профиль свои необычные скилы. Никогда не знаешь, кому понадобится сделать технический перевод с китайского на абланский :)
  7. Расширяйте свой visibility. Создавайте аккунты в социальных сетях, в одноклассниках, вконтакте, моем круге...
  8. Постоянно улучшайте свой профиль.
  9. Будьте начеку: просматривайте предложения по проектам, которые вам интересны, пишите хорошие сопроводительные письма и отвечайте на звонки и email.
  10. Не стоит недооценивать себя. Работа клиента - экономить, а ваша задача - просить за свою работу соответствующую плату.
Несомненно, всегда будет кто-то, чья работа стоит дешевле или дороже вашей. Клиенты соизмеряют цену с репутацией фрилансера, его скилами и опытом. Устанавливайте цену, которая отражает ваши таланты, учитывает отзывы и делайте все, что можете, чтобы продемонстрировать, что вы стоите этих денег.


27 октября 2008

Быстрее, выше, сильнее...

Недавно наткнулся на перевод статьи Эвана Миллера "Как стать Open-Source подрядчиком". Автор пишет как он зарабатывает деньги разрабатывая открытые приложения для Nginx. Собственно, меня заинтересовал не рассказ о Nginx. Миллер писал о том, чем должен обладать человек, чтобы стать "ценным кадром", авторитетным подрядчиком (несмотря на то, что в переводе упоминается слово "подрядчик", что в английском языке должно выглядеть как "contractor", будем считать, что подрядчик=программист-фрилансер).

Итак, чтобы не перечитывать всю статью, привожу наиболее интересные для фрилансеров моменты:

Если вы хотите быть успешным подрядчиком, вы должны стать редким ресурсом. Вы должны уметь делать что-то лучше, чем почти все разработчики конкретной компании. А менеджеры должны думать: “Было бы классно нанять этого парня, но давайте попробуем заполучить хотя бы немного его времени.”

Вся штука состоит в том, чтобы стать экспертом в чем-то. Желательно — мировым экспертом. Это не значит, что вы должны знать что-то лучше, чем кто-либо в мире; это просто значит, что вы можете продемонстрировать свои знания в какой-то области так же хорошо, как и кто угодно другой. Не нужно доказывать, что вы лучший; просто нужно, чтобы никто другой не доказал, что лучший — он.

Далее идет список афоризмов с комментариями, отражающими опыт автора:

На кухне шеф-повара нож, который может резать все, не режет ничего.
Чтобы быть подрядчиком, надо иметь специализацию. “Умный и дело делает” — этого недостаточно. Вам нужно уметь делать что-то лучше, чем делают большинство людей в компании, которая вас нанимает. Выберите систему, программу или набор библиотек, где вы бы могли специализироваться. Выберите что-то, что вам интересно. Но при выборе учтите и тот фактор, что выбранное вами должно быть востребовано маленькими и средними компаниям. Пишите патчи, создавайте новые функции, приложения и плагины, пока не поймете, что вы своим вопросом владеете не хуже кого-бы то ни было другого. А потом докажите это.

Хороший учитель — лучше, чем великий ученик. 
Чтобы стать известным, как «эксперт», пишите о том, о чем вы знаете. Давайте пояснения в руководствах. Участвуйте в списках рассылки. Приходите на конференции. Но помните…

За большими замками прячутся маленькие секреты. 
Не делитесь всеми своими знаниями. Неплохо бы припрятать немного колдовства в рукаве. Еще лучше вскользь упомянуть, что вы опускаете какие-то “детали”.

Большинство идут к шарлатану в офис, а не к доктору на дом. 
Представьте себя. Сделайте вебсайт, где вы объясняете, чем занимаетесь. Люди ведь не с помощью телепатии вас найдут.

Сегодня — стежок, завтра — костюм. 
Компании, которые вас нанимают, могут иметь в перспективе несколько проектов, и начнут они с самого маленького для пробы. Если работа невелика, соглашайтесь на любую цену. Если вы произведете на них впечатление, в следующий раз вам предложат что-то намного прибыльнее.

И, наконец, один совет не в форме афоризма:

Выглядите профессионалом. Раздавайте визитные карточки на конференциях. Сделайте шаблон счета-фактуры. Называйте расценки за свою работу с уверенностью. Сдавайте проекты раньше срока. Пишите тесты и документацию. Пишите именно то, что хочет клиент, а не то, что хочет видеть, по вашему мнению, весь мир. И пишите без ошибок.

Конечно это не универсальный набор советов на все случаи жизни, но, думаю, поможет как начинающим фрилансерам, так и более опытным собратьям.

22 октября 2008

Сколько стоит сделать проект?

Очень часто читаю о спорах фрилансеров о том, какой способ оплаты лучше - почасовой или за проект (с предоплатой и без). Честно говоря, я не могу сказать, какой из способов лучше, а какой хуже. Давайте разберемся в достоинствах и недостатках каждого метода (применительно к фрилансерам-программистам).

СпособДостоинстваНедостатки
Повременная оплата
  1. Оплата работы фрилансера напрямую зависит от количества отработанного времени;
  2. Можно не волноваться о новых функциях и изменениях в проекте - все оплачивается заказчиком без проблем;
  3. Периодическое получение денег.
  1. Сложность учета времени как для фрилансера, так и для заказчика;
  2. Оплата за отработанное время расслабляет фрилансера, эффективность работы может падать без хорошей самомотивации (аналогично: работа стремится занять все время, отпущенное на ее выполнение).
Фиксированная оплата за проект
  1. В счет сразу закладываются все возможные затраты, что увеличивает сумму оплаты;
  2. В отличие от повременки возникает желание быстрее закончить проект;
  3. Можно попросить часть денег вперед.
  1. Нужно уметь правильно оценивать сложность проекта и временные затраты, иначе можно оказаться "в пролете";
  2. В случае незапланированных изменений в проекте работа может стать нерентабельной, если менеджер не умеет просить увеличение бюджета.

Конечно, универсального решения на все случаи жизни не бывает и для каждого случая нужно взвешивать все "за" и "против". Иногда заказчик сам определяет способ оплаты, иногда все определяется после общения с заказчиком.

Могу сказать только одно: добросовестный заказчик всегда пойдет вам навстречу и вы получите свои деньги. Тот же, кто пытается сэкономить, выжмет из вас все соки при любом способе оплаты. Я не помню, кто это сказал, но фраза мне очень понравилась:
Есть два типа заказчиков: которым нужно решать свои проблемы, и которые хотят подешевле.
Решайте сами с кем и как вам работать...

25 сентября 2008

Фриланс: Как написать сопроводительное письмо

Сегодня в рассылке одной из бирж фриланса нашел очень интересную статью, про то, как надо писать сопроводительно письмо для своего бида на бирже. Я использовал слова "сопроводительное письмо" как перевод "cover letter". Мне не очень нравится русский вариант, но другого я не нашел. В любом случае, те, кто хоть раз бывал на биржах фриланса, знают, что cover letter - это текст, сопровождающий вашу ставку на проект.

Несмотря на то, что в оригинале статья называется "Writing a Killer Cover Letter", я назвал этот пост по-другому.

Далее привожу сплав свободного перевода и моих собственных мыслей:

Есть тысячи способов испортить свое сопроводительно письмо. Клиенты каждый день просматривают список из 30, 50 или даже 100 кандидатов и любая деталь, в которой что-то не так может раздражать человека, читающего письмо. Это ваш первый и возможно единственный способ произвести впечатление на потенциального клиента. Совершите ошибку - и вы будете немедленно вычеркнуты из списка. Фрилансер, который понимает эту жесткую реальность, может применять это на благо себе. Хотите писать более эффективные сопроводительные письма? Вот несколько советов, которые помогут вам выделиться из толпы (в хорошем смысле):
  • Краткость - сестра таланта. Если ваш текст такой же длинный как этот пост - урежьте его хотя бы на треть. Все, что клиент хочет видеть - это вежливое приветствие, предложение или два, описывающие ваши наиболее релевантные способности и возможно еще предложение или два о вещах, не указанных в профиле - например, вы только что закончили два аналогичных проекта. В конце - вежливое прощание.
  • Следуйте указаниям. Если вас попросили ответить на определенные вопросы или включить какие-то данные в ваше письмо - так и сделайте. Остерегайтесь опечаток: напишите письмо в текстовом редакторе и проверьте отсутствие ошибок, а затем прочитайте его вслух. Попросите друга просмотреть его перед отправкой - две головы лучше чем одна.
  • Никогда не используйте заготовки. Искушенные клиенты всегда распознают заготовку и никогда не наймут такого фрилансера. Потратьте 5 минут и напишите то, что требует клиент. Совет прост: пишите каждый раз с чистого листа.
  • Следите за своим тоном. Даже если клиент пишет немного легкомысленно, вы должны быть серьезным, но не напряженным. Это письмо от одного профессионала к другому. Не будьте забавны, многословны или чрезмерно лестны. Будьте услужливы и уверенны, не высокомерны, и не выглядите особенно нуждающимися.
  • Полегче с жаргоном. Используйте технические термины правильно. Клиент не будет в восторге от ваших планов "реализовать" ваш "доказанный потенциал", чтобы "добиться максимальных результатов" и "удовлетворить клиента". Вопреки некоторым мнениям, вы не можете загипнотизировать клиента "возбуждающими" умными словами.
  • Ссылайтесь на примеры. Перечислите, дайте ссылки или прикрепите к письму примеры своей работы, чтобы продемонстрировать вашу профпригодность. Если ваше портфолио еще не включает релевантных позиций - не забудьте их добавить позднее.
Даже если вы хорошо поработали над своим профилем, клиент никогда не потрудится посмотреть его, если ваше сопроводительное письмо не будет служить кратким, эффективным и привлекательным. Если Голливуд может сжать двухчасовое кино до размеров 90-секундного ролика, вы тоже можете написать свое сопроводительное письмо размером до 300 слов и суметь оставить ваших клиентов желать больше.